WebMay 15, 2024 · The calculated Weibull breakdown strengths (α b) of the pure PTFE and epoxy films are 415 kV/mm and 327 kV/mm, respectively. The α b of the epoxy flattened PTFE films P-0.25%E, P-0.5%E and P-1%E are 423 kV/mm, 555 kV/mm and 462 kV/mm. As shown in Fig. 4b, the α b increases firstly and then decreases. WebA breakdown mechanism is proposed in which a filamentary-shaped crack propagates through a dielectric, releasing both electrostatic energy and electromechanical strain energy stored in the material due to the applied electric field.
